TVX was an alternative community video broadcaster founded by the New Arts Lab in London in 1969, distributing documentaries, drama, news, talk shows, film and much more.

Carla Liss arrived in London in 1968 and became the Co-op's first and for many years only employee. Her role organising distribution led to an important set of New American Cinema prints being deposited in London. n November 1968, a fall-out over the future direction of the Arts Lab created an organisational split. The Co-op collection was temporarily housed in members' flats before new premises were found near Euston Station.
